You could write a function … WebJan 6, 2024 · Here are the steps to set the tab size to the number of spaces you desire: Create a .vimrc file under your home directory ~/, if it does not already exist. In the .vimrc file, add the following: set tabstop=3 set shiftwidth=3 set expandtab. tabstop means how long each tabstop will be.

WebJul 22, 2024 · g, – move to next instance in change list; g; – move to previous instance in change list; Macros. qa – record macro a; q – stop recording macro; @a – run macro a … WebOct 15, 2024 · And you want to enforce a particular indentation style, in this case, a 4 space indentation. In your ~/.vimrc file, add this options: syntax enable set smartindent set tabstop=4 set shiftwidth=4 set expandtab. Your tabs will now be 4 spaces, new lines will be auto-indented and curly braces will be aligned automatically. Source: Stack Overflow.

WebUsing tabs for indentation. If you want to use only tabs for indentation (not spaces), enter the following command (replace 4 with your preferred column width for each indent level): :set noet ci pi sts=0 sw=4 ts=4. The previous line is an abbreviated equivalent of these commands: :set noexpandtab :set copyindent :set preserveindent :set ... WebEdit the 'Target' box in the Properties of the gvim shortcut to read (you may need to change this for your path to gvim): "C:\Program Files\Vim\vim71\gvim.exe" --remote-tab-silent. In Windows Explorer, right-click one or more files, and select Send To, gvim in the context menu.
